wcfdbwacl With Victory and Peace must also come communication and understanding among the world's citizens. A knowledge of mod- ern languages will help promote this new world citizenship, while the study of Latin will keep alive the culture ofthe past . . . lil Explaining the Italian posters to an interested class is Miss Grace Emery, head of the Latin department . . . l2l Knowledge ofthe arts, as well as the language, oFFers one of the closest bonds between the Good Neighbors. . . . l3l Important at present for military purposes, German will be vital after the war in promoting trade and improving international relationships . . . l4l Mr. Charles C. Martin, head of the Modern Language department, explains the Alliance Francaise medal to his ad- vanced French class . . . l5l Conversational Spanish introduces the pupil to the lan- guage and customs of Spanish-speaking countries.

D1 54 Because mathematics is needed in every branch of the Armed Forces and in the rebuilding of nations, pupils who take math courses at Tech will be well prepared for the future . . . lil For proficiency in mathematics, senior boys work problems in War Arithmetic . . . l2l Knowledge of the geometry of spheres, which is necessary in all branches of engineering and navigation, is taught in Solid Geometry . . . l3l Seeing stars from the Tech campus are pupils of astronomy who may be future navigators on the sea and in the air . . . l4l Often found in conference with students is Mr. A. M. Welchons, head of the department . . . l5l Modern technology and military and naval tactics demand a knowledge of trigonometry.
